Amendola, Krista, Marie, MD

525 Spruce St Ste 3
San Francisco, CA 94118

SF Bay Pediatrics operates two pediatric offices in San Francisco and Mill Valley, providing dedicated care for the health and well-being of children. With a team of Board Certified Pediatricians, they emphasize the importance of healthy families and communities in raising happy, healthy children.

The practice focuses on making the parenting experience rewarding while ensuring each child's full potential is reached. In addition to regular check-ups, they offer various services, including well and sick child visits, walk-ins, and video consultations.

Generated from the website

Own this business?
See a problem?

You might also like

United StatesCaliforniaSan FranciscoAmendola, Krista, Marie, MD

Partial Data by Infogroup (c) 2025. All rights reserved.